Decoding the Difference: Wedding vs. Venue Coordinators

As the echoes of wedding bells fill the air, the importance of a well-coordinated and seamless celebration cannot be overstated. You might have heard the terms “wedding coordinator” and “venue coordinator” tossed around, and you may wonder, are they interchangeable roles? The answer is a resounding no. In the intricate tapestry of wedding planning, each plays a unique role, and understanding the distinction is key to crafting the perfect day.

1. Comprehensive Planning:

Wedding Coordinator: Imagine a maestro orchestrating a symphony; that’s the wedding coordinator. From the first notes of vendor selection to the final crescendo of the last dance, they conduct every aspect of your wedding.

Venue Coordinator: Their expertise lies in the venue itself, managing the logistical dance of setup and breakdown within their facilities.

2. Vendor Coordination:

Wedding Coordinator: The liaison between all vendors, ensuring a harmonious collaboration and flawless execution.

Venue Coordinator: Primarily concerned with vendors linked directly to the venue, like catering and sometimes decor.

3. Timeline Management:

Wedding Coordinator: Crafting and executing a meticulous timeline for the entire wedding day, from the first light of dawn to the last dance beneath the stars.

Venue Coordinator: Focuses on the venue-specific timeline, encompassing setup, meal service, and cleanup.

4. Personalization and Design:

Wedding Coordinator: The artist behind the scenes, infusing the wedding with the couple’s vision, from color schemes to intricate details.

Venue Coordinator: Centers on the aesthetic elements within the venue, potentially overlooking the broader design aspects.

5. Problem Solving:

Wedding Coordinator: The troubleshooter extraordinaire, handling unexpected issues that may arise to ensure an unblemished experience.

Venue Coordinator: While adept at venue-related challenges, they may not be equipped for broader wedding-related issues.

6. Ceremony and Reception Coordination:

Wedding Coordinator: The seamless conductor of both ceremony and reception, ensuring a harmonious transition between the two.

Venue Coordinator: Focuses predominantly on the logistics within the venue, especially during the reception.

7. Personal Attention:

Wedding Coordinator: Offers personalized attention, understanding the couple’s unique needs and preferences to tailor the experience.

Venue Coordinator: Concentrates on the venue’s logistics, potentially missing the broader vision the couple envisions.

8. Flexibility and Adaptability:

Wedding Coordinator: An agile navigator, ready to handle changes or unexpected situations, adapting seamlessly throughout the planning process and on the big day.

Venue Coordinator: Primarily concerned with the venue’s facilities and services, their flexibility might be limited regarding broader wedding-related changes.

In summary, while a venue coordinator is indispensable for managing venue-specific details, a wedding coordinator is the mastermind behind the entire symphony of your wedding.
